Comprehending Wooden Pallets
Wooden pallets are flat structures Purchase Used Wooden Pallets for carrying and keeping items. They are normally made from different kinds of wood and be available in various sizes, with the most common being the basic 48 inches by 40 inches (1200 mm by 1000 mm) used in North America. Wooden pallets play a crucial function in logistics, as they help with simpler handling, filling, and discharging of products.

Wooden pallet depots have actually become important hubs for the recycling, repair work, and distribution of wooden pallets. As companies acknowledge the value of sustainability, these depots have ended up being main to the logistics and supply chain industry. They help business manage their pallet stock, decrease waste, and reduce costs associated with acquiring new pallets.
Benefits of Wooden Pallet Depots
Ecological Sustainability: Wooden pallet depots promote recycling and recycling pallets, substantially reducing timber waste and deforestation.

Cost-Efficiency: Businesses can save cash by repairing and recycling pallets instead of constantly purchasing new ones.

Quality Control: Wooden Pallets Buy pallet depots keep strict quality control steps to ensure that refurbished pallets fulfill safety and resilience standards.

Reduced Carbon Footprint: By extending the life cycle of wooden pallets, depots contribute to decreasing the overall carbon footprint of logistics operations.

Boosted Inventory Management: Depots provide businesses with effective management of pallet inventories, enabling much better tracking and usage.

Wooden pallet depots embody the concepts of a circular economy by assisting in the reuse, reconditioning, and recycling of wooden pallets. Rather than adhering to a traditional linear economy-- in which items are Used Pallets Buy and dealt with-- depot operations emphasize sustainable practices, where materials are continuously repurposed.

How do I pick the best wooden pallet for my requirements?
When picking a wooden pallet, think about factors such as load capacity, resilience, and whether you require block or stringer styles based on your storage and transportation requirements.
2. What is the average life-span of a wooden pallet?
The lifespan of a wooden pallet can vary considerably depending upon use and maintenance. A well-kept pallet can last anywhere from 5 to 15 years.
3. What should I finish with damaged pallets?
Harmed pallets can frequently be fixed to extend their life. If repair is not practical, numerous Cheap Wooden Pallets pallet depots will accept them for recycling.
4. Exist policies concerning using wooden pallets?
Yes, specific markets, such as food and pharmaceuticals, have particular guidelines concerning the use and treatment of wooden pallets to guarantee safety and hygiene.
